Mar 3, 2023 · Proposed rule would limit duration of coverage under short-term health plans to 4 months. Rule would roll back limits from the current rule, which allows STLDI plans to have terms of less than 12 months and maximum durations up to 36 months. How to buy health insurance today. There are 4 types of health insurance plans namely, MediShield Life, Integrated Shield plan (IP), international health insurance (local provider), international health insurance (global provider). MediShield Life is the most basic type of health insurance, so it covers only the lower wards like Class B2 and C, surgery coverage is capped at ...

Plans typically last less than a year but can sometimes be extended up to 36 months. Nov 22, 2023 · Short-term health insurance in Georgia. You can buy short-term health insurance in Georgia. The state follows federal regulations for these types of policies, meaning the plans have a maximum length of one year and can be renewed for up to 36 months. There are many different health care plans out there; some that offer coverage for limited needs, some that are …In Illinois, short-term health insurance is limited to six months, after lawmakers overrode the governor’s veto of legislation to create that rule. Additional legislation is under consideration in 2023 in Illinois that would require a short-term plan to end no later than December 31 of the year in which it’s issued, even if that would mean …There are multiple health insurance plans available, which differ by network size, covered services, flexibility, out-of-pocket costs and price. UnitedHealthcare’s Bronze Plan offers the most affordable monthly premium but has the highest out-of-pocket costs for health care services. It covers 60% of health care expenses while the remaining 40% is divided to be paid by the beneficiary as a co-payment, co-insurance, or deductible.
